In February, the enchanting island of Kos experiences a temperate climate characterized by an average temperature of 14°C (57°F), peaking at a delightful 18°C (66°F) during the day, while nighttime can drop to a brisk 4°C (40°F). The month is marked by moderate rainfall, accumulating to 108 mm (4.2 in) over 11 days, contributing to the lush landscapes for which the island is known. With an average humidity level of 76%, visitors can expect a refreshing but occasionally damp atmosphere, making February an ideal time to explore Kos's natural beauty and historical sites without the summer crowds.

In February, Kos, Greece experiences a noticeable decline in precipitation, with an average of 108 mm (4.2 in) over approximately 11 days of rain. This marks a significant drop from the 193 mm (7.6 in) recorded in January and indicates the retreat of the island's wet winter season. As the month progresses, the weather begins to transition into the drier spring months, setting the stage for a shift towards notably less rainfall in March and beyond. The pattern reveals a clear trend: as winter wanes, Kos sees a gradual decrease in both precipitation amounts and rainy days, thereby welcoming longer periods of sunshine and pleasant weather.

In comparing the weather patterns of January and February, we see slight variations in temperature and precipitation. February typically has a minimum temperature of 4°C (40°F), slightly cooler than January's 5°C (41°F), while both months share the same maximum temperature of 18°C (66°F). The average temperature in February is marginally higher at 14°C (57°F) compared to January's 13°C (55°F). Notably, February experiences less rainfall, with 108 mm (4.2 in) over 11 days, whereas January has a considerably higher precipitation of 193 mm (7.6 in) across 14 days.
